Catharina Paukner Krzysztof K K Koziol Chandrashekhar V Kulkarni

We present the fabrication of lipid nanoscaffolds inside carbon nanotube arrays by employing the nanostructural self-assembly of lipid molecules. The nanoscaffolds are finely tunable into model biomembrane-like architectures (planar), soft nanochannels (cylindrical) or 3-dimensionally ordered continuous bilayer structures (cubic). T. Erdmann S. Pierrat P. Nassoy U. S. Schwarz

We probe the dynamic strength of multiple biotin-streptavidin adhesion bonds under linear loading using the biomembrane force probe setup for dynamic force spectroscopy. Measured rupture force histograms are compared to results from a master equation model for the stochastic dynamics of bond rupture under load. Xiaofan Li Zhenyao Xia Jianqiang Tang Jiahui Wu Jing Tong Mengjie Li Jianhua Ju Huirong Chen Liyan Wang

Chemical epigenetic manipulation was applied to a deep marine-derived fungus, Aspergillus sp. SCSIOW3, resulting in significant changes of the secondary metabolites. M S Jablin K Akabori J F Nagle

Recent simulations have indicated that the traditional model for topographical fluctuations in biomembranes should be enriched to include molecular tilt. Here we report the first experimental data supporting this enrichment. Utilizing a previously posited tilt-dependent model, a height-height correlation function was derived. A Fuliński P F Góra

We discuss new examples of the constructive role of environmental fluctuations in biophysical processes, namely quantitative enhancement and qualitative sharpening of the outgoing signal in the intercellular signal transduction, e.g., in the synaptic links. An experimental check in a chemical flow reactor is suggested.

Sreetama Pal Amitabha Chattopadhyay

Biological membranes are complex quasi two-dimensional, supramolecular assemblies of a diverse variety of lipids, proteins and carbohydrates, that compartmentalize living matter into cells and subcellular structures.
